Morda is a Rural village located in Pachpahar, Jhalawar, Rajasthan.

The total population of Morda is 612.

Morda village comprises 125 households.

The literacy rate in Morda is 54.3%. Among the literate population of 290, there are 217 literate males and 73 literate females.

In Morda, there are 323 males and 289 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1000 males.

There are 78 children (12.7% of population), comprising 40 boys and 38 girls.

The total number of workers in Morda is 239, with 234 main workers and 5 marginal workers.

In Morda, there are 66 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(36 males, 30 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Morda is located in Rajasthan state, Jhalawar district, and falls under Pachpahar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 104916 and LGD code is 104916.
